About Marlborough Sauvignon Blanc

Allan Scott Marlborough Sauvignon Blanc is an estate-driven expression from the Rapaura/Upper Wairau vineyards in Marlborough, showing the region’s characteristic interplay of racy acidity and intense aromatics — think passionfruit, guava and grilled pineapple balanced with zesty lime, herbaceous notes (capsicum, chervil/dill) and a flinty/mineral thread. Crafted for freshness (cool fermentation, careful parcel selection), it’s light to medium-bodied, vibrantly fruity and designed to drink young with seafood, salads or simply chilled on its own…
